Abstract

The invention discloses a circulating lubricating system with an automatic cleaning function. The circulating lubricating system comprises a settling pond, wherein a foam separation plate capable of blocking the foam on the surface layer of lubricating liquid is arranged in the settling pond, the settling pond is divided by the foam separation plate into a foam isolation area and an impurity settling area, a return liquid pipe is arranged in the foam isolation area, the lubricating liquid containing impurities enters the foam isolation area by virtue of the return liquid pipe and then enters the impurity settling pond so as to settle impurities, an impurity clearing device capable of clearing the impurities on the bottom of the impurity settling area is arranged in the impurity settling area, and a liquid pumping pipe capable of pumping the clean lubricating liquid is arranged on the rear end of the impurity settling pond. By adopting the circulating lubricating system with the automatic cleaning function, the foam can be reduced and isolated, and the impurities on the bottom of the settling pond can be online cleared.

Background technology
In Production for Steel Wire industry, wet draw refer to steel wire hauled between mould by and the extruding being subject to mould reaches the production technology of the steel wire radial dimension wanted fast.
Usually wetting draws circulating oil system to refer to: wet and draw lubricating fluid required in production process to extract from sedimentation basin, and after wet drawing, impure lubricating fluid can get back to precipitated impurities in sedimentation basin again, and constantly dewing draws production process to provide lubricating fluid and so forth.
The above-mentioned wet shortcoming of circulating oil system of drawing is: one, impure lubricating fluid is when entering in sedimentation basin, because the back-flow velocity of lubricating fluid is too fast, impure lubricating fluid can form impact and disturbance in sedimentation basin, thus produce a large amount of foam, foam can float on lubricating fluid top layer in whole sedimentation basin, the difficulty of cleaning can be increased like this, and foam can be wrapped up in band impurity and float on lubricating fluid top layer, thus make contamination precipitation slow, lubricating fluid in sedimentation basin due to contamination precipitation slowly can be muddy all the time, reduce the greasy property of lubricating fluid, can cause like this wetting and break silk, Steel Wire Surface is injured, wet drawing-die tool consume increases the situation generation waiting and affect product quality, two, the impurity bottom sedimentation basin is difficult to cleaning, impurity is cleared up not in time and lubricating fluid also can be caused muddy, thus affect the greasy property of lubricating fluid, and during each cleaning sedimentation basin impurities at bottom, all need to stop producing, so just have impact on production efficiency, in addition, the waste water produced during cleaning impurity is more, so also can to environment.

Detailed description of the invention
Below in conjunction with specific embodiments and the drawings, the present invention is described in further detail.
A kind of circulating oil system with automatic cleaning function, as shown in Figure 1, comprise sedimentation basin 1, the foam dam 11 that can stop lubricating fluid skin foam is provided with in sedimentation basin 1, foam dam 11 is separated into foam isolated area 12 and contamination precipitation district 13 sedimentation basin 1, the length in contamination precipitation district 13 is 20 ~ 30m, liquid back pipe 14 is provided with in foam isolated area 12, lubricating fluid containing impurity enters foam isolated area 12 by liquid back pipe 14, and then enter contamination precipitation district 13 precipitated impurities, arrange like this and foam can be made to be terminated in foam isolated area 12, thus do not affect contamination precipitation in contamination precipitation district 13, the length in contamination precipitation district 13 is limited, to make impurity have more sufficient distance to precipitate, the impurity cleaning device can cleared up the impurity bottom contamination precipitation district 13 is provided with in contamination precipitation district 13, the liquid suction pipe 171 that can extract clean lubricating fluid is provided with in the rear end in contamination precipitation district 13, in the present embodiment, the structure of impurity cleaning device is: what move forward and backward along contamination precipitation district 13 scrapes mud dolly 2, in actual applications, guide rail can be set at the side in contamination precipitation district 13, scrape mud dolly 2 at moving on rails, scrape mud dolly 2 to be hinged with the rear end of connecting rod 21, the front end of connecting rod 21 is provided with cleaning shoe 211, cleaning shoe 211 is placed in contamination precipitation district 13, scraping driving mechanism mud dolly 2 being also provided with and can lifting connecting rod 21, in the present embodiment, driving mechanism is cylinder 22, the rear end of cylinder 22 with scrape mud dolly 2 and be hinged, piston rod part and the connecting rod 21 of cylinder 22 are hinged, contamination precipitation district 13 bottom front near foam dam 11 rear portion is provided with impurity collection pit 23, impurity collection pit 23 is connected with blow-off pipe 231, blow-off pipe 231 is provided with the blowoff valve 232 be controlled by the controller, scrape mud dolly 2 to be moved by contamination precipitation district 13 rear end forward end with the cleaning shoe 211 tactile with contamination precipitation district 13 bottom connection, thus make the impurity bottom contamination precipitation district 13 by cleaning shoe 211 with falling into impurity collection pit 23, when scraping the front end of mud dolly 2 by contamination precipitation district 13 and moving to the back-end, cylinder 22 piston rod can shrink to lift connecting rod 21, cleaning shoe 211 is made to be 20 ~ 40cm with the distance bottom contamination precipitation district 13, here the height that cleaning shoe 211 is lifted is set, in order to the current of generation when preventing cleaning shoe 211 from being moved to the back-end by the front end in contamination precipitation district 13 can move together backward with the impurity again precipitated, thus pollute the lubricating fluid of sedimentation basin 1 rear end cleaning.In the present embodiment, the liquid barrier 141 that can stop the lubricating fluid flowed out in liquid back pipe 14 is also provided with in foam isolated area 12, liquid barrier 141 can slow down the back-flow velocity of impure lubricating fluid, thus reduce rolling disturbance that impure lubricating fluid formed and impact, reach the object reducing foam.
In the present embodiment, feed tube 15 is provided with in foam isolated area 12, new lubricating fluid flows into foam isolated area 12 by feed tube 15, feed tube 15 is provided with liquid feed valve 151, liquid level gauge 16 and lower liquid level gauge 161 on being also provided with in sedimentation basin 1, upper and lower liquid level gauge 16,161 is connected with controller communication, and liquid feed valve 151 is under control of the controller.Controller can determine whether liquid feeding according to the feedback of upper and lower liquid level gauge 16,161.In addition, the mud speed of scraping of scraping when mud dolly 2 is moved by contamination precipitation district 13 rear end forward end is 0.5 ~ 1.5m/min, setting slower mud speed of scraping is to prevent settled impurity from again kicking up, the reset speed of scraping when mud dolly 2 is moved to the back-end by front end, contamination precipitation district 13 is 1.5 ~ 3m/min, it is slightly fast that reset speed ratio scrapes mud speed, such setting is the time in order to reduce reset on the one hand, thus improve the efficiency of impurity cleaning, be also to prevent cleaning shoe 211 from making settled impurity again kick up because reset speed is too fast on the other hand.
A kind of operation principle with the circulating oil system of automatic cleaning function described in the present embodiment is: as shown in Figure 1, wetting draws used lubricating fluid in production process can enter the foam isolated area 12 of sedimentation basin 1 from liquid back pipe 14, when entering sedimentation basin 1, lubricating fluid can be subject to the stop of liquid barrier 141, thus reduce time liquid speed of lubricating fluid, reach the object reducing foam, then lubricating fluid can enter in contamination precipitation district 13 through foam dam 11, and at this moment foam dam 11 can block the foam on lubricating fluid top layer, makes foam can not enter in contamination precipitation district 13, lubricating fluid precipitates in contamination precipitation district 13, and the liquid suction pipe 171 of rear end, contamination precipitation district 13 is provided with delivery pump 17, and delivery pump 17 extracts the clean lubricating fluid completing precipitation to be carried out dewing and draw production process to provide lubrication, when needs are removed contamination, in contamination precipitation district 13 arrange scrape mud dolly 2 can under the control of the controller with contamination precipitation district 13 bottom connection touch cleaning shoe 211 be moved by contamination precipitation district 13 rear end forward end, thus make the impurity bottom contamination precipitation district 13 by cleaning shoe 211 with falling into impurity collection pit 23, controller also can open blowoff valve 232 on time makes the impurity in impurity collection pit 23 drain, after cleaning shoe 211 falls into impurity collection pit 23 with impurity, controller can control the contraction of cylinder 22 piston rod and lift connecting rod 21, cleaning shoe 211 is not touched with contamination precipitation district 13 bottom connection, then scrape mud dolly 2 to be moved to the back-end by the front end in contamination precipitation district 13 with cleaning shoe 211 again and reset, cleaning shoe 211 so constantly repeats to clear up impurity, when the liquid level of lubricating fluid in sedimentation basin 1 is lower than lower liquid level gauge 161, lower liquid level gauge 161 can send a signal to controller, then controller can be opened liquid feed valve 151 and comes sedimentation basin 1 liquid feeding, when the liquid level of lubricating fluid is higher than upper liquid level gauge 16, upper liquid level gauge 16 can send a signal to controller, and then controller can cut out liquid feed valve 151 and stops to sedimentation basin 1 liquid feeding.
